On March 17, 2015, Lead Director Network (LDN) members met in New York to discuss different approaches to refreshing the board. This ViewPoints presents a summary of the key points, along with background information and selected perspectives that members shared before and after the meeting.

Executive Summary:

Lead directors shared ideas and practices on three broad topics in their discussion of board refreshment:

.. Board composition (page 2) -

Investors are putting more pressure on boards to think like owners as they oversee management. In response, boards are taking steps to ensure that they are composed of non-executive directors who can guide the company and its strategy into the future. In many cases, this means considering new directors who have different professional skills and experience or can enhance board diversity with respect to age, gender, and ethnicity. Directors highlighted the benefits of adding new members who can bring fresh perspectives to boardroom discussions...
